Crisp, hazy and nicely tinted bronze and amber coloured body with a bit of a ruby glow at the bottom with a perfect, two centimetre tall tan head. Aroma of pungent pineapple, citrus, piney and sweet hops with a lot of honey and resin noticeable and quite a bit of alcohol. Full-bodied; Super malty at first with a resinous bite of hops, some pineapple and floral hop notes also come through, but a lot of sugars and even more alcohol. Aftertaste shows a lot of all these tastes with a hint of fruit, some piney bitterness and a great sweet finish complete with the hop flavours really going strong. Overall,a very nice Imperial IPA, I just would have preferred a smaller format bottle, but I know this is what they do out West, and at least they charge a respectable price. 22 ounce bottle into tulip glass, no bottle dating. Pours lightly hazy golden orange color with a nice 2 finger fluffy white head with good retention, that reduces to a small cap that lingers. Spotty soapy lacing clings to the glass. Aromas of big mango, pineapple, orange peel, pepper, clove, banana, bubblegum, herbal, floral, grass, earth, and spicy yeast esters. Damn nice aromas with good balance, complexity, and strength of hop and yeast ester notes. Taste of big mango, pineapple, orange zest, banana, clove, pepper, pear, bubblegum, grass, floral, bread, honey, and earthy yeast spiciness. Lingering notes of citrus, tropical fruit, clove, banana, pepper, floral, grass, pear, and earthy yeast spiciness on the finish for a good bit. Fantastic complexity and balance of hops flavors and spicy yeast esters; with zero cloying flavors present after the finish. Medium carbonation and fairly full bodied; with a slick and lightly sticky mouthfeel that is nice. Alcohol is well hidden with only a moderate warming noticed after the finish. Overall this is a highly excellent hoppy Belgian strong golden ale! Great complexity and balance of hop and yeast esters; and very smooth to sip on for 10%. A highly enjoyable offering.
